Had 'premium' wifi on my last TA (Oct-Nov '23) and no big issues. Was able to stream YT without major hiccups. Starlink makes it more reliable than whatever was there before, but you are still on a moving platform, in the middle of the ocean, and bouncing off several satellites 🙂 The biggest question is how much are you willing to pay/day for it though, and snap that deal once it comes 😉 (i.e. set yourself a limit and if the prices go down and hit it, just do it)

During our last TA (Nov 2023) the 'default' IP went to Piraeus Greece after leaving the spanish/portugese coast/EEE/coverage/etc. The cruise started in Barcelona, so I was expecting it to default to Spain, but nope. -

Just returned from a 19 Oct to 2 Nov TA on the Reflection. The 'new(ish)/updated/etc' starlink was ok for internet. Of note, the capped speed on the "Premium" package was approx 550KB/s (half a megabyte / sec); and very usable with youtube videos. (Did not test netflix/disney/paramount/HBO/etc) I tested this by saturating my connection link via nord VPN and downloading big files (500-2000MB range). Note: without the VPN, the transfer would freeze after 15-30 mins; with the VPN, transfers could still freeze, but less often. A simple refresh of the browser would continue the transfer, but I 'lost' approx 10-15% of the progress (i.e if I transferred 650MB and it froze, the reload would restart the transfer at the 500-525MB mark). The overall *responsiveness* is the same on the basic and premium internet. We did experience some dips in the speeds in areas where antenna and satellite positions required a handshake/hand off to a better signal. (This lasted at most 5 minutes though). I'm glad I was able to upgrade from the Basic to Premium package for 5.xx$/day though. -
